Calculate Flow Requirements

Flow information is an important part of equipment selection.

Buyers should determine the expected flow in the primary and secondary circuits.

Pump capacity, system load, temperature differences, and zone requirements may all influence the required flow.

Rather than choosing a model solely according to pipe diameter, buyers should compare the expected circulation conditions against the manufacturer's technical specifications.

Evaluate Pump Coordination

Projects using multiple pumps require careful system planning.

Primary and secondary circuits may operate under different flow conditions.

Buyers should provide pump information, circuit requirements, and piping diagrams when discussing product selection.

The equipment should be considered as one part of the complete circulation system rather than evaluated independently.

Review Insulation Options

Insulation requirements depend on the project.

Buyers should discuss insulation material, thickness, outer covering, installation method, and expected operating environment.

Heating applications may have different requirements from cooling systems.

If insulation is needed, its dimensions should be included in the technical drawing so the final external size remains clear.
